What's it like to stay in a motel?
Motel properties often have free parking, and many also feature an outdoor pool. Often one or two storeys high, motels usually have outdoor access to guestrooms from the car park. Beginning in the early 1950s, colourful neon signs were used as beacons for tired families on road trips, and today, examples of these can still be found along historic US Route 66.

What's the weather like in Wivenhoe Hill?
Weather can make or break a road trip, so here's some data about year-round temperatures in Wivenhoe Hill to help you plan yours: The hottest months are usually January and December, with an average temperature of 24°C, while the coldest months are July and August, with an average of 15°C. Average annual precipitation for Wivenhoe Hill is 911 mm.
